Pat B:
Pearlie, Patrick(Jackcrafty) has a great build along in the How To section but it was a few years back so you will have to look. I built one a few years ago too so you might look for that one too.
 I cut the pelt apart and built the quiver and strap, some parts lined with leather(thin garmet leather). Patrick built his the way the NAs built theirs(tail first) but it seemed backwarcs to me so I built the one I did with the animal facing forward.
